Minister’s address on Civilian Oversight at Olive Convention Centre in Durban, KwaZulu-Natal

On the 11 November 2014, the Minister of Police, Honourable Nkosinathi Nhleko addressed stakeholders from various organisations on the issues of civilian oversight. The event was hosted by Civilian Secretariat for Police and was held at Olive Convention Centre in Durban, KwaZulu-Natal.

The purpose of this event was to communicate the role and functions of the Civilian Secretariat for Police (CSP). In his address, the Minister stated, “we need to form civilian oversight body structures that will promote and support public safety and protection in our communities”.

The Acting Secretary of Police, Ms Reneva Fourie spoke on the roles and functions of the Civilian Secretariat for Police
